Michigan State Betting Information
- The Spartans are under .500 against the spread this season with a record of 4-13
- Only 8 of 17 Michigan State games this season (47.1%) resulted in a total greater than the contest’s over/under.
- In their last game, the Spartans got a team-high 27 points from Aaron Henry on the way to a 78-71 victory against Indiana on Saturday. They covered the spread as 6.5-point underdogs, and the teams combined to score 149 points to hit the over on the 134.5 point total.
Against the Spread (ATS) records are only reflective of games that had odds on them.

Illinois Betting Information
- Illinois has regularly covered the spread this season with a record ATS of 12-7-1.
- 11 of Illinois’ 20 games (55%) this season have covered the over/under.
- Their last time out, the Fighting Illini saw Kofi Cockburn put up a team-high 22 points to lead them to a 94-63 win against Minnesota on Saturday. They were 4-point favorites and covered the spread, and the teams scored 157 total points to top the 145.5-point over/under.
Against the Spread (ATS) records are only reflective of games that had odds on them.
